Output 8b58e63a9aac3453e4c68d2fe2de8e31e8b238aa5bbd027e62238dd1b0b1c122:0

value
34410
script pubkey
OP_0 OP_PUSHBYTES_20 6dee57cc3eaa2c4cd1686247ccf33a4e5df27af1
address
bc1qdhh90np74gkye5tgvfrueue6fewly7h3f66rl6
transaction
8b58e63a9aac3453e4c68d2fe2de8e31e8b238aa5bbd027e62238dd1b0b1c122
confirmations
93392
spent
true